When you're a rap star, you're entitled to certain indulgences. Some of Young Jeezy's are chicken and Patron, apparently.

In July, while Jizzle was in town for the Cleveland Summer Jam, he and Machine Gun Kelly joined forces on wax for "Hold On (Shut Up)," which hit the 'net earlier this month. MGK recently recounted the memorable studio session.

"The funniest part of that shit, is that he’s so famous, he has a rider when he comes in the studio," the Bad Boy signee told XXLMag.com. "He requested fuckin’ chicken, fish, Belvedere and Patron—at four in the morning on a Sunday in Cleveland, Ohio."

At first, it seemed like the Atlanta native's requests would be too much. "I’m like, ‘Yo, how the fuck are we gonna get this?’" Kells continued. "And a chicken spot opened up just for us. They came back and opened up and cooked the chicken for us, and we just paid ’em extra. They held us down. It was crazy.

"He actually let me go do an after party I was booked for, and he just stayed in the studio and did it. He was like, ‘By the time you come back, it’ll be done.’ I was like, ‘Hell, yeah.’"

MGK's debut album, Lace Up, is set to hit stores October 9. —Adam Fleischer (@AdamXXL)
